How easy is it to replace a heater core on a 1999 Silverado pickup truck. Engine size 5.3 liter with AC not an extended cab but a 4x4. How long would an experienced mechanic work on completing this task.
I believe that one is a nightmare and calls for about 10 hours!! A guy who does them all the time I know of can get it down to 4 hours. Requires dropping steering wheel and whole dash off and all the connections removed and replaced perfectly or you are back again!
